Home Grown Transplant chief rooted in Georgia

BY DAMON CLINE

A sizeable number of patients arriving at MCGHealth Medical Center for a kidney or pancreas transplant come from rural Georgia towns that most physicians have never heard of, let alone find on a map. But when they meet transplant surgeon Dr. James J. Wynn, they find someone who knows exactly where they’re coming from.

“I

’m as home grown as anyone around here,” says Wynn, a native of Statesboro, Ga., who has spent nearly his entire career at the Medical College of Georgia, his alma mater. Those Georgia roots help him better relate to the large rural population served by MCG, one of three transplant programs in the state. “What makes us different from the two programs in Atlanta is that we’re basically a rural program,” says Wynn, who holds the Mason Distinguished Chair in Transplant Surgery and Immunology. “We have a long track record taking care of rural Georgia.” He has performed more than 1,000 transplants since joining the MCGHealth Kidney and Pancreas Transplant Program in 1987, nearly two decades after Dr. Arthur Humphries Jr. performed MCG’s

first kidney transplant in 1968. Wynn, who worked with Humphries during his surgical residency, replaced him as medical director of the program in 1995. Wynn, who performed the first pancreas transplant at MCG in 1994, does an average of eight surgeries a week, mostly kidney transplants and creating dialysis access ports (called fistulas) in patients who will eventually need a transplant. He has worked on patients ranging from an 80-year-old to a toddler weighing less than 20 pounds. As busy as he is, he’s been even busier in the past; before Dr. Todd Merchen joined the program in 2007, and at various other times in the program’s history, Wynn was the sole surgeon. “I’m pretty sure God has given each of us a finite number of all-nighters,” he says. “I’m getting very close to using all of mine up.” continued
